A small deciduous tree of the Moringaceae family (APG classification: Moringaceae). Also called Moringa. Native to India and Myanmar (Burma). It grows to a height of several meters and has grey, corky bark. The leaves are alternate, tripinnate, compound, about 60 cm long, and grey-white on the underside. The flowers are white, butterfly-shaped, five-petaled, fragrant, and borne in panicles in the leaf axils. The fruit is rod-shaped, 30-60 cm long, with nine ridges, and hangs from the branches. Inside the fruit are spherical, winged seeds. The entire plant is pungent. The roots are particularly pungent and are used as a spice. The immature fruit is called drumstick, and is a common vegetable in India. The seeds also contain high-quality oil, which is pressed and called ben oil or moringa oil, and used to make high-quality machine oils for watches and other equipment. It is also used as salad oil and perfume oil. It reproduces by seed, grows quickly, and is widespread throughout the tropics. The family Moringaceae is a dicotyledonous, polypetalous plant. It is a herbaceous shrub with 10 species in one genus, distributed throughout the tropics.
